Diet could: As your diet regulates the consistency of your stool and too watery or too solid a stool can irritate the perianal area. But also things like psoriasis can also cause perianal irritation. Even things like parasites(pinworms) can cause irritation and chron's disease an inflammatory condition involving the gastrointestinal tract. You may want to review this with a gastroenterologist.
